Alimentiv is a specialty contract research organization focused on gastrointestinal (GI) and liver diseases. With over 30 years of experience, Alimentiv offers a comprehensive range of clinical research and imaging services, including clinical trial management, site management, regulatory affairs, and precision medicine. The company is at the forefront of medical research and development, providing state-of-the-art imaging solutions and actionable biomarker insights. Alimentiv supports the development of GI compounds and is active in more than 60 countries, working with a network of medical and operational experts to accelerate clinical trials and patient recruitment.

📋 Description

• The Team Lead, Payroll will be responsible for accurate processing of payroll, benefits administration, reconciliations and government remittances globally. • Support the Payroll Team in responding to questions or concerns fully, and in a timely manner to ensure internal customer satisfaction. • Develop, implement, and evaluate payroll strategy, practices, processes and technology solutions in conjunction with the Sr. Manager, People & Culture. • Interface with People & Culture, Finance, vendors, leaders and employees; contribute to and lead special projects as assigned. • Supervise daily activities of the Payroll Team, providing support, mentorship, guidance, workload distribution, and handling escalations. • Lead Payroll Team in full cycle payroll preparation and administration globally in compliance with legislation in each country. • Ensure accurate and timely processing of wage adjustments, retroactive pay, statutory holiday pay, overtime, bonuses, deductions, contributions, and other compensation elements for direct employees and EOR workers. • Implement and oversee monthly reconciliation process for accounting & finance. • Resolve payroll discrepancies and answer employee queries with urgency. • Act as primary liaison with outsourced payroll vendor, driving accountability for service levels and issue resolution. • Keep abreast of legislative changes globally and coordinate system parameter changes. • Ensure payroll data integrity across HRIS, payroll, and vendor systems. • Oversee payroll calendar and payday schedules globally. • Maintain employee confidence and confidentiality in payroll operations. • Respond to stakeholders in timely manner and work cross-functionally with HR and Finance. • Establish, track, and report on Payroll Team performance against service level agreements. • Prepare and maintain payroll process documentation; train and support team members. • Prepare reports for management, finance and auditors; oversee audits with government agencies when necessary. • Prepare accurate and timely reconciliations; support year-end financial audit and other audits. • Audit payroll data for accuracy and compliance; monitor accounting policies and internal controls. • Supervise, mentor, train, and oversee development of direct reports; set performance goals and development objectives. • Evaluate training needs and conduct performance reviews; support staffing decisions; onboard and train new staff. • Participate in development and execution of departmental strategies; assist with departmental budget planning. • Act with integrity, model ethical practices, adhere to payroll legal requirements, and maintain awareness of global trends. • Support other HR and/or payroll projects/duties as assigned.

🎯 Requirements

• 4 - 9 years of progressive payroll experience, including leadership or team lead responsibilities with proven project management skills • PCP or CPM designation (or international equivalent) required; strong knowledge of payroll regulations, tax laws, and compliance requirements • Experience in accounting/reconciliations of payroll liabilities accounts and knowledge of Payroll GL • Hands-on experience with outsourced payroll vendors (global payroll experience preferred), HRIS, and payroll systems • Intermediate knowledge of Microsoft Excel • Experience managing payroll across multiple jurisdictions; strong knowledge of Canadian and US payroll required, with global exposure highly valued • Exceptional attention to detail • Ability to prioritize multiple tasks while meeting deadlines timely and accurately • Strong verbal and written skills, to align with various stakeholders and maintain strict confidentiality • Excellent customer service skills, ability to explain complex issues at an understandable level
